My favorite place to be in the morning is definitely in my studio, and this morning has been no exception. I was up early making these blocks for a new pattern. It's far from finished but I am having so much fun designing with this fabric line that I wanted to share some pictures.

This fabric collection will be available in October. It's called Aster Manor by Three Sisters for Moda fabric.
